About the role
ECLARO is looking for a Right of Way Specialist for a client in New York, NY. The role involves assisting in the acquisition of right of way (ROW) for linear and site-specific projects within the energy infrastructure industry. The position is suited for professionals with proven expertise who value professionalism and quality in delivering complex projects.
Responsibilities
- Assist in acquiring ROW for linear and site-specific projects.
- Request, prepare, obtain, and document survey permissions from owners and tenants.
- Identify issues for proposed routes, necessary agency/entity permits, and required exhibits for negotiations.
- Prepare and file permit applications required by affected agencies/entities.
- Assist in establishing project routes, estimating ROW costs for selected routes and alternates, and establishing acquisition timelines.
- Assess program procedures, practices, philosophies, and documentation for compliance with specifications, contracts, and mission requirements.
- Request payment for all ROW as agreed, according to procedure.
- Document all off-ROW damages incurred during construction and resolve with contractors and owners/tenants.
- Process all requests for encroachment from third parties on ROW.
- Attend, participate in, support, analyze, provide input to, develop, prepare, and report on: reports, correspondence, meetings, conferences, and review boards.
- Communicate directly with co-workers and provide information to supervisors, co-workers, and subordinates via telephone, written form, email, or in person.
- Coordinate activities of individuals during land, ROW, or permit acquisitions for one or more projects as assigned.
- Perform other duties as assigned, including the ability to perform responsibilities of a Document Specialist when needed.
Required Qualifications
- One to three years of acquisition and negotiation experience, preferably related to transmission easement acquisitions including oil, gas, and electricity.
- Position requires extensive travel (expected to be 90%); valid driver’s license and acceptable DMV record required.
- Ability to perform all key qualifications of a Document Specialist.
- Strong customer focus to ensure project meets operational requirements.
- Ability to read and comprehend legal documents such as ground leases, easements, deeds, land purchase contracts, mortgages, title policies, and subordination.
- Ability to work and be available during non-standard work hours to accommodate landowner schedules.
- Ability to work and communicate effectively with all levels of co-workers, clients, and external contacts.
